Ubuntu 15.10: USN-2825-1 Critical: Oxide Browser Application Crash

Numerous vulnerabilities in the Oxide web rendering engine have been resolved to avert possible security breaches and software failures.
Several security issues were fixed in Oxide.

Summary

Several security issues were fixed in Oxide.

Software Description:

- oxide-qt: Web browser engine library for Qt (QML plugin)

Details:

Multiple use-after-free bugs were discovered in the application cache

implementation in Chromium. If a user were tricked in to opening a

specially crafted website, an attacker could potentially exploit these to

cause a denial of service via application crash, or execute arbitrary code

with the privileges of the user invoking the program. (CVE-2015-6765,

CVE-2015-6766, CVE-2015-6767)

Several security issues were discovered in the DOM implementation in

Chromium. If a user were tricked in to opening a specially crafted

website, an attacker could potentially exploit these to bypass same

origin restrictions. (CVE-2015-6768, CVE-2015-6770)

A security issue was discovered in the provisional-load commit

implementation in Chromium. If a user were tricked in to opening a

Update Instructions

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:

Ubuntu 15.10:
  liboxideqtcore0                 1.11.3-0ubuntu0.15.10.1

Ubuntu 15.04:
  liboxideqtcore0                 1.11.3-0ubuntu0.15.04.1

Ubuntu 14.04 LTS:
  liboxideqtcore0                 1.11.3-0ubuntu0.14.04.1

In general, a standard system update will make all the necessary changes.
